Living in Kansas, storms are an unavoidable part of life — and they can do a number on your roof. The good news is that in many cases, homeowners insurance may cover storm-related roof damage. But navigating the claims process can be confusing. Here’s what every homeowner should know.

What Types of Storm Damage Are Covered?

Most homeowners insurance policies cover damage from:

  • Wind and Hail: These are among the most common causes of roof claims in Kansas.
  • Falling Debris: Trees or limbs that fall on your roof during a storm are typically covered.
  • Water Damage (with conditions): If water enters due to storm damage, it may be covered, but flooding from ground water usually is not.

What’s Not Covered?

  • General Wear and Tear: Insurance doesn’t cover damage due to age or lack of maintenance.
  • Improper Installation: If your roof wasn’t installed properly, you may be on the hook.
  • Neglect: Delayed repairs or failure to maintain your roof can void coverage.

Tips for Filing a Successful Claim

  1. Document the Damage: Take clear photos and videos immediately after the storm.
  2. Get a Professional Inspection: Gorilla Exteriors can assess damage and provide a detailed report.
  3. Notify Your Insurance Company Promptly: Waiting too long can complicate your claim.
